Sikkim Manipal College of Nursing (SMCON) offers a 2-year Master of Science in Nursing at Gangtok, with an annual intake of 25 seats across five clinical specializations. Admission is through NEET-PG, and candidates must have at least one year of post-registration nursing work experience. The total course fee is INR 2,96,000. SMCON provides clinical training access at SMIMS, a major teaching hospital in Northeast India.

SMU Sikkim M.Sc Nursing Fees 2026

ComponentAmount (INR)
Tuition Fee (per year)INR 1,45,000
Registration Fee (one-time)INR 1,000
Caution Deposit (refundable, one-time)INR 5,000
Hostel Charges (optional)Charged separately
Total Fees (2-year programme, excluding hostel)INR 2,96,000
  • Tuition payable as lump sum of INR 1,45,000 or in two installments of INR 75,400 each per year.
  • Caution deposit of INR 5,000 is refundable upon course completion.
  • Sikkim Government Quota students pay a reduced annual tuition of INR 78,000.

Eligibility Criteria

  • B.Sc Nursing, B.Sc Hons. Nursing, or Post Basic B.Sc Nursing with minimum 55% marks
  • Registered as a Nurse and Midwife with a State Nursing Council
  • Minimum 1 year of clinical work experience after registration as a nurse
  • Valid NEET-PG score from the applicable admission cycle
  • Medically fit as certified by a registered medical practitioner
  • Candidates with distance education nursing degrees must provide NOC from the Indian Nursing Council

Admission Process

  • Appear in NEET-PG and obtain a valid score for the applicable cycle
  • Apply online to SMCON at smu.edu.in/smcon before July 25, 2026
  • Merit list prepared on the basis of NEET-PG score and work experience
  • Shortlisted candidates complete document verification at the SMCON campus in Gangtok
  • Pay admission fees and obtain confirmation of specialization allotment
  • Report to SMCON for class commencement in August 2026

SMU Sikkim M.Sc Nursing Scholarships 2026

ScholarshipAmountEligibility
PG Merit Scholarship20% tuition concessionAbove 75% or CGPA 7.5 and above in qualifying degree
PG Merit Scholarship10% tuition concession65% to 75% or CGPA 6.5 to 7.5 in qualifying degree
Girl Child Scholarship20% tuition concessionFemale students with family income below INR 8 Lakhs
Single Mother Scholarship20% tuition concessionChildren of single mothers with family income below INR 8 Lakhs
Sports Achievement Scholarship30% tuition concessionNational or international level sports representation
  • Only one scholarship applies per student at a time throughout the programme.
  • A minimum CGPA of 7.5 must be maintained each year to retain scholarship benefits.

SMU Sikkim M.Sc Nursing FAQs

Ques. Is NEET-PG required for M.Sc Nursing admission at SMCON SMU Sikkim?

Ans. Yes, NEET-PG is the qualifying entrance examination for M.Sc Nursing admission at Sikkim Manipal College of Nursing. Candidates must have a valid NEET-PG score from the applicable admission cycle. In addition to the NEET-PG score, candidates must hold a B.Sc Nursing degree with at least 55% marks and have completed a minimum of one year of registered nursing work experience post-qualification.

Ques. What specializations are available in M.Sc Nursing at SMCON?

Ans. SMCON offers M.Sc Nursing in five specializations: Pediatric Nursing, Obstetrics and Gynaecological Nursing (OBG), Medical-Surgical Nursing, Mental Health and Psychiatric Nursing, and Community Health Nursing. Students are allotted a specialization based on their NEET-PG rank and seat availability across the 25-seat annual intake. Each specialization includes structured clinical postings at the SMIMS teaching hospital departments.

Ques. What is the total fee for M.Sc Nursing at SMCON SMU Sikkim?

Ans. The total fee for the 2-year M.Sc Nursing programme at SMCON is INR 2,96,000, excluding hostel. This includes annual tuition of INR 1,45,000, a one-time registration fee of INR 1,000, and a refundable caution deposit of INR 5,000. Tuition can be paid as a lump sum or in two installments of INR 75,400 each per year. Sikkim Government Quota students pay a reduced annual tuition of INR 78,000.

Ques. What work experience is required for M.Sc Nursing eligibility at SMCON?

Ans. Candidates applying for M.Sc Nursing at SMCON must have a minimum of one year of clinical nursing work experience after completing registration as a nurse with a State Nursing Council. This experience must be post-registration, meaning it should be gained after passing B.Sc Nursing and completing the mandatory internship. Experience certificates from the employing hospital must be submitted at the time of document verification.
